Residential community 5 miles north of downtown
Meadowbrook Forest is a suburban neighborhood in Norfolk, bounded by North Military Highway and Lake Whitehurst. The community started development in the 1960s after Norfolk annexed land from Princess Anne County. The area has an easy commute to work for Norfolk Naval Station, the largest naval base in the world, and nearby coastal recreation at Oceanview's Beaches. The neighborhood also has an active civic league, lakeside homes and convenient eateries and shops. “We feel like our own little city, it’s a great microcosm of what a community should look like,” says Christian Strange, Treasurer of the Lake Whitehurst West Civic League.
Suburb with distinct character
The neighborhood has a distinct character thanks to its variety of home styles and classic municipal decor. “The streets are lined with gas lamps making a walk at night very picturesque,” says Strange. Cottage-style homes, ranches and colonials make up most of the area's inventory. Down Hunter’s Trail, you’ll find larger, contemporary lakeside homes encompassed by woods, creating a sense of seclusion. Homes in the neighborhood typically range from $300,000 to $500,000.

Norfolk Botanical Garden, Oceanview
While there aren’t any parks directly in the neighborhood, there are close options for getting outdoors. The Norfolk Botanical Garden is nearby with 7 miles of trails through seasonal floral arrangements. There’s also a community garden on Johnstons Road, run by the nearby Larrymore Lawns Association. For indoor recreation, there’s an AMF bowling alley just north on East Little Creek Road. Two miles north is Oceanview, offering beach access and a large fishing pier.

Events hosted by the Lake Whitehurst West Civic League
The Lake Whitehurst West Civic League, the second-largest league in Norfolk, serves several communities, including Meadowbrook Forest. The league also hosts a summer block party and a holiday social. “Our civic league is sort of an extension of the government, and we are always looking out for each other,” says Strange.
Easy access to Naval Station Norfolk
A few shops and restaurants are within walking distance, but residents will still want a car to access to rest of Norfolk’s amenities. Interstate 64 is nearby and provides an easy commute to Naval Station Norfolk and the rest of Hampton Roads. There are several bus stops with daily service along N Military Highway. Norfolk International Airport, one of the largest in the region, is just 2 miles east.
